Job Description

**Responsibilities** **Position Summary:** The Surgery Scheduler interfaces with patients, surgery facility, anesthesiologist and provider to perform all functions related to the coordination of scheduling surgery. Scheduler will log and file all surgery requests from providers. **Core Duties:** + Document and input into IDX all HMO surgery authorization request + Complete all pre-op forms (blood work, ekg, chest x-ray, etc.) + Collect all lab results, chest x-rays, EKG, orders, etc. and fax to facility the day before surgery along with authorization forms + Generate labels and complete top portion of encounter forms the day before surgery and distribute along with charts to providers office + Register new hospital patients into IDX + Review and complete all surgery and hospital encounter forms from providers; highlight, copy, batch, and send to Data Drive + Submit for scanning all completed surgery forms (surgery request form, labs, orders, etc.) into EMR chart after encounter forms are completed + Contact health plans to obtain authorization for all PPO surgeries + Schedule surgeries either by facsimile or telephone call in the IDX system + Schedule pre-op and post-op appointments in IDX system + When applicable, complete form from Blood Bank and fax to facility for all autologous blood donations for total joint surgeries + Complete surgery information forms for patients; includes EKG requests, Chest x-rays, etc. and mail to patients + On an as-needed basis, the Surgery Scheduler will coordinate physician core and call schedule for hospital, distribute schedule to all providers and call center monthly, prepare monthly access report and schedule all department depositions and court appearances with assigned staff member + Coordinate all required surgical medical equipment with 3rd party vendors + Effective communication with surgery facility, anesthesiologist, patient and provider + Perform any other duties as assigned by supervisor ***This position is represented by SEIU United Healthcare Worker. **Qualifications** **Minimum Qualifications:** + High school diploma required (or equivalent) + **_One (1) year experience in a surgery scheduling setting and/or minimum two (2) years clinical back office experience required_** + Excellent interpersonal, organizational and customer service skills required + Keyboarding skills and the ability to utilize computer equipment and software are required, as is experience with other types of standard office equipment + Being a team player, able to multi-task, self-starter, detail oriented and being proactive required **Preferred Qualifications:** + Current California CMA cert preferred + Familiarity with an electronic practice management system is preferred + Experience with multi-line phones/ACD phones preferred + Medical terminology preferred **Overview** Dignity Health Medical Foundation, established in 1993, is a California nonprofit public benefit corporation with care centers throughout California.
